About Platte, South Dakota

Platte lies under a sky that stretches wide and deep, a canvas of ever-shifting blues and grays over rolling prairie. It lies 108.1 miles west of Sioux Falls, SD (from Sioux Falls, SD: bearing 265°T), and is situated 22.1 miles north-west of Lake Andes. The land here is a gentle swell of earth, stitched with fields of corn and soybeans that, in the summer sun, gleam a vibrant green, and in the autumn, fade to hues of gold and russet. The air, especially in the late afternoon, carries a certain crispness, a clean scent of turned soil and distant rain. A quiet stillness often settles over Platte, broken only by the low drone of a passing truck or the distant call of a hawk circling high above. The history of Platte is tied to the rich agricultural heartland of South Dakota, a story built on the resilience of pioneers who saw potential in this fertile ground. The local economy, then as now, is deeply rooted in farming and ranching, a steady pulse that has sustained the community for generations. You can still feel the echoes of that founding spirit in the sturdy brick buildings downtown and the friendly nods exchanged between neighbors. While no grand monuments mark its landscape, Platte possesses a distinctive character, a quiet strength born from its connection to the land and the enduring traditions of its people.
